public static class FamilyMemberHistory.Condition extends BackboneElement
The significant Conditions (or condition) that the family member had. This is a repeating section to allow a system to represent more than one condition per resource, though there is nothing stopping multiple resources - one per condition.

Method Detail
- 
getCode
public CodeableConcept getCode()
The actual condition specified. Could be a coded condition (like MI or Diabetes) or a less specific string like 'cancer' depending on how much is known about the condition and the capabilities of the creating system.- Returns:
 - An immutable object of type 
CodeableConceptthat is non-null. 
 
- 
getOutcome
public CodeableConcept getOutcome()
Indicates what happened following the condition. If the condition resulted in death, deceased date is captured on the relation.- Returns:
 - An immutable object of type 
CodeableConceptthat may be null. 
 
- 
getContributedToDeath
public Boolean getContributedToDeath()
This condition contributed to the cause of death of the related person. If contributedToDeath is not populated, then it is unknown.- Returns:
 - An immutable object of type 
Booleanthat may be null. 
 
- 
getOnset
public Element getOnset()
Either the age of onset, range of approximate age or descriptive string can be recorded. For conditions with multiple occurrences, this describes the first known occurrence. 
- 
getNote
public List<Annotation> getNote()
An area where general notes can be placed about this specific condition.- Returns:
 - An unmodifiable list containing immutable objects of type 
Annotationthat may be empty.
